Chapter 22 Picking up mistakes on the way

Different colors appeared in the night sky. The bird that had the upper hand was like a ball of fire, spitting out a huge ball of flame and heading straight towards the other bird. The ball of flame lit up half of the night sky.

The other seriously injured bird did not give in because of the injury. It was still strong and used its wings to flap the flame ball away, but its momentum had quietly declined.

After another collision, the seriously injured bird had its wings scratched and fell diagonally to the west.

The other fiery red bird naturally would not miss this good opportunity and followed closely behind, wanting to deal with it directly.

What is unexpected is that the seriously injured bird pretended that its wings were seriously injured and could not fly.

When the fiery red bird flew closer, it let out a shrill scream.

Even Wei Zhuo and Chen Shuixin, who were far away, were shaken by the sudden screams, their ears were numb, and they seemed to lose their balance.

The fiery red bird in front was even more shocked and dizzy.

At this moment, the seriously injured bird suddenly pierced the neck of the fiery red bird with its long beak.

The fiery red bird suddenly struggled violently, but could not break free.

Suddenly its whole body seemed to be ignited with flames, and the flames enveloped the seriously injured bird. Finally, the two birds became entangled and fell together in the west.

A frightening drama staged in the middle of the night finally came to an end.

Chen Shuixin felt a little emotional, feeling that his horizons had finally been opened, and he knew the fighting methods of birds, such as spitting fire, attacking with sound, using oneself to lure the enemy, and so on.

She also deeply felt her own shortcomings. Her thoughts still accounted for more people than birds. In fact, this was very unfriendly to her who had not yet transformed.

Change is still necessary. If you don't change, just wait for society to teach you a lesson.

One person and one chicken watched "Enter the Dragon" for the rest of the night, not to mention enjoying it.

It is only said that Wei Zhuo recognized that the one with fiery red feathers was a bird, and that it had the blood of the phoenix.

Wei Zhuo and Chen Shuixin suggested that he wanted to pick up the leak before dawn.

Chen Shuixin knew full well that Wei Zhuo was doing it for her, so she didn't stop Wei Zhuo. She was going to follow Wei Zhuo anyway.

Wei Zhuo left Pegasus in the camp. When the two birds were fighting, Pegasus had been subdued by their power and was still in panic.

Wei Zhuo disliked Pegasus being in the way, so he thought he would go to the west to pick up the leaks, then find Pegasus and leave here directly.

Wei Zhuo took out two invisibility charms from his storage bag, affixed one to himself and Chen Shuixin, and lurked toward the west.

It was extremely quiet along the way. Two birds were fighting. The monsters and humans on the ground who were lower than them did not dare to make any sound. They were afraid that any movement would directly offend the birds and be destroyed.

The nearby mountains and forests are not very far from the town, so there are no high-level monsters occupying the territory.

This is also the reason why Wei Zhuo dared to stay in the wild at night.

But, on the first day of sleeping in the wild, I encountered two birds fighting, and blood was spilled on the tent where they lived.

Even if he could find out later, Wei Zhuo still felt that he must go to town and stay at an inn today to get a good night's sleep.

Such a quiet mountain forest made Wei Zhuo and Chen Shuixin walk very smoothly.

After walking for about two-quarters of an hour, one person and one chicken saw the flames rising into the sky in front of them, and faintly heard a whimpering sound.

Wei Zhuo immediately stopped, hugged Chen Shuixin and leaned against the tree and waited for a while until there was no sound.

He clearly saw how the two birds fought, and how the seriously injured bird used itself to lure the enemy and finally killed him.

Although I don’t know whether the counterattack was successful in the end, it is indeed powerful and useful.

He didn't dare to bet on whether he would be able to trigger the protective shield given by A Niang in time.

Chen Shuixin watched the fire ahead become smaller and reminded Wei Zhuo, 'There is no sound now. Let's go quickly. I'm afraid that if it takes too long, it will attract monsters.'

Wei Zhuo nodded, holding Chen Shuixin and approaching the place quietly.

The two birds, which had lost all sound, were still entangled with each other.

The beak of the roc was still pierced around the neck of the fiery red bird. It seemed that the counterattack was successful, but it itself was almost burned to black charcoal by the flames covering the fiery red bird.

Wei Zhuo didn't have time to think too much, so he first removed the stored magic weapons from the two birds, and then directly put away the two entangled corpses.

After doing this, he took Chen Shuixin and left without wasting a single minute.

Quick and accurate!

Chen Shuixin was dumbfounded. She realized that she had completely underestimated Wei Zhuo.

It took Wei Zhuo less than two-quarters of an hour to return to the camp, put away the tent, took back the formation disk, hitched the Pegasus to the carriage, held Chen Shuixin in the carriage, and drove away.

That's it, don't forget to label the Pegasus and the carriage with concealing and silencing symbols.

This set of movements is very smooth, but nothing is done carelessly.

Wei Zhuo is well versed in the principle of "soldiers are more valuable than speed".

When the sky was slightly bright, they finally saw a small town, but they didn't stop for a moment and went straight to the next small town.

Chen Shuixin originally suggested taking a short rest and replacing some elixirs and herbs.

Wei Zhuo said, "I saw in the 58th article of the life diary given by the fifth senior brother that when you are trying to make a fortune, you should also pay attention to the surrounding environment and people. After making a fortune, you should not stay in nearby towns to avoid

Attract the attention of suspicious people!"

‘What?’ Chen Shui was heartbroken.

Wei Zhuo explained, "Someone in this small town may have noticed what happened in the early morning, and someone may have the same mentality as me and go to pick it up."

"Now we enter the town at dawn, obviously to tell everyone that we have walked all night, so those who are interested may speculate that we picked up the two birds and attack us."

"At this time, our approach is to stay out of the door and avoid all future troubles!"

"Awesome, really awesome", Chen Shuixin was really impressed and wanted to see what else was written in that life diary.

In the evening, after walking all day without stopping, they finally saw the shadow of a small town.

Wei Zhuo drove the Pegasus quickly towards the small town.

After entering the small town, we headed to the city center and found the largest and most brilliant-looking inn to stay.

Wei Zhuo asked for a superior room, and also selected the do not disturb mode, turned on the protective array in the room, and kept the confidentiality work in place.

Chen Shuixin asked with great interest, 'Is this also what was written in that life diary?'

Wei Zhuo nodded, "This is Article 29. Choosing the most expensive inn in the city center is a good choice when you don't know the city. If you are more expensive, you will not only have a comfortable stay, but also have good safety performance.

You can also get some basic information from the store owner.”

"Of course, if you want to live in this city longer, you have to look again."
